The Graduates and Old Students Democratic Association (; GOSDA) was a political party in Myanmar.
Following the reintroduction of multi-party democracy after the 8888 Uprising, the party contested ten seats in the 1990 general elections. It received 0.08% of the vote, winning one seat; U Maung Maung Aung in Pabedan.
The party was banned by the military government on 11 March 1992.
